Taang (टांग)
Origin: Hindi
Taang is an Hindi word, it means “the leg/a share” in English, while in Hindi it’s also called as “pair/पैर, ansh/अंश.”
For eg: “Chal taang utha ke, nacche….” which means, “let’s dance raising the legs.”
Taang also means “hang” in English, while in Hindi it’s called as “latkana/लटकाना.”
For eg: “Dil ki deewaron pe taang li hai….” which means, “hanged on the walls of heart.”
